I had my iPhone 6 Plus on the night stand and was using my Ipad mini.

For some reason I lost control of my iPad and it tumbled from my hands to the night stand a hits the iPhone 6s Plus screen directly on the screen right where the home button is.

Screen is cracked, TouchID no longer works and the button itself gets really warm if phone is on even for a few minutes.

I do not have AppleCare plus. It's 30 days old today.

Off to the Genius Bar today to confess that I am not a genius.

Went back today.

Actually it would have cost $149.

I bought AppleCare and had the phone swapped out for $99. (they wanted to replace the screen but I had time pressures.)

Now I think I got the wrong model back from them (I bought a sim-free completely unlocked phone, and this one asked to lcok to a carier. The lady at the store assured me it was fine, but I'm going to escalate it with phone support - I think this phone is locked.)

At least I have a working phone and the chance to break it one more time under warranty.
